#ifndef ARCHIVE_WRITER_ENTRY_HPP_INCLUDED
#define ARCHIVE_WRITER_ENTRY_HPP_INCLUDED
#include <archive.h>
#include <archive_entry.h>
#include <string>
#include <cstdint>
#include <istream>
#include <memory>
#include <linux/types.h>
#include "archive_reader_entry_buffer.hpp"
namespace ns_archive {
class entry
{
public:
entry(archive_entry* entry, ns_reader::entry_buffer& entry_buffer); // TODO change to private and friend reader?
entry(std::istream& stream);
void clear_entry(std::istream& stream);
int64_t get_header_value_gid();
int64_t get_header_value_ino();
int64_t get_header_value_ino64();
int64_t get_header_value_size();
int64_t get_header_value_uid();
mode_t get_header_value_mode();
mode_t get_header_value_perm();
dev_t get_header_value_rdev();
dev_t get_header_value_rdevmajor();
dev_t get_header_value_rdevminor();
std::string get_header_value_gname();
std::string get_header_value_hardlink();
std::string get_header_value_pathname();
std::string get_header_value_symlink();
std::string get_header_value_uname();
unsigned int get_header_value_nlink();
void set_header_value_gid(int64_t value);
void set_header_value_ino(int64_t value);
void set_header_value_ino64(int64_t value);
void set_header_value_size(int64_t value);
void set_header_value_uid(int64_t value);
void set_header_value_mode(mode_t value);
void set_header_value_perm(mode_t value);
void set_header_value_rdev(dev_t value);
void set_header_value_rdevmajor(dev_t value);
void set_header_value_rdevminor(dev_t value);
void set_header_value_gname(const std::string& value);
void set_header_value_hardlink(const std::string& value);
void set_header_value_link(const std::string& value);
void set_header_value_pathname(const std::string& value);
void set_header_value_symlink(const std::string& value);
void set_header_value_uname(const std::string& value);
void set_header_value_nlink(unsigned int value);
void set_header_value_mtime(time_t time, long value);
archive_entry* get_entry() const;
std::istream& get_stream();
private:
std::shared_ptr<archive_entry> _entry;
std::istream _stream;
bool _has_stream;
};
}
#endif // ARCHIVE_WRITER_ENTRY_HPP_INCLUDED
